[發(fā)明專利]基于指紋相似度的設(shè)備分類方法有效
| 申請(qǐng)?zhí)枺?/td> | 201910735429.8 | 申請(qǐng)日: | 2019-08-09 |
| 公開(公告)號(hào): | CN110458094B | 公開(公告)日: | 2020-12-18 |
| 發(fā)明(設(shè)計(jì))人: | 林星辰;黃元飛;李燕偉;夏劍鋒;張峰;權(quán)曉文;王潤合;黃石海;趙建聰 | 申請(qǐng)(專利權(quán))人: | 國家計(jì)算機(jī)網(wǎng)絡(luò)與信息安全管理中心;遠(yuǎn)江盛邦(北京)網(wǎng)絡(luò)安全科技股份有限公司 |
| 主分類號(hào): | G06K9/00 | 分類號(hào): | G06K9/00;G06K9/62 |
| 代理公司: | 北京遠(yuǎn)大卓悅知識(shí)產(chǎn)權(quán)代理有限公司 11369 | 代理人: | 程麗娜 |
| 地址: | 100020*** | 國省代碼: | 北京;11 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 基于 指紋 相似 設(shè)備 分類 方法 | ||
本發(fā)明公開了一種基于指紋相似度的設(shè)備分類方法,包括:建立已知的同一類型設(shè)備的樣本集,提取樣本集對(duì)應(yīng)的指紋信息,以得平均相似度和中心點(diǎn)樣本指紋集;獲取樣本集內(nèi)的每個(gè)設(shè)備與中心點(diǎn)樣本指紋集的相似度,計(jì)算每個(gè)已知類型設(shè)備指紋信息相似度到中心點(diǎn)樣本指紋集的相似距離,確定最大相似距離;計(jì)算未知類型設(shè)備集內(nèi)每個(gè)樣本與中心點(diǎn)樣本指紋集所在的中心點(diǎn)樣本的空間距離,若大于最大相似距離,則樣本屬于中心點(diǎn)樣本集所在的樣本類型,否則,樣本不屬于樣本類型,若出現(xiàn)未正確識(shí)別樣本,重新加入樣本集,重新計(jì)算中心點(diǎn)樣本,以完成自動(dòng)分類。本發(fā)明提高了設(shè)備分類的效率和準(zhǔn)確性,并避免了因信息發(fā)送變化導(dǎo)致的指紋識(shí)別失敗的問題。
技術(shù)領(lǐng)域
本發(fā)明涉及數(shù)據(jù)處理技術(shù)領(lǐng)域,尤其涉及一種基于指紋相似度的設(shè)備分類方法。
背景技術(shù)
隨著對(duì)網(wǎng)絡(luò)安全的日漸深入,對(duì)于網(wǎng)絡(luò)資產(chǎn)的梳理變得越來越重要,其中,包括網(wǎng)絡(luò)設(shè)備的操作系統(tǒng)類型、開放的服務(wù)、banner信息、證書信息、使用的中間件、Http響應(yīng)頭信息等多個(gè)維度的綜合信息描述,對(duì)設(shè)備進(jìn)行分類和識(shí)別。但是隨著網(wǎng)絡(luò)設(shè)備、軟件的不斷更新,應(yīng)用層協(xié)議指紋更新更是層出不窮,傳統(tǒng)的指紋識(shí)別大多采用單條件逐個(gè)匹配,如果中間某一個(gè)信息發(fā)生變化,則會(huì)導(dǎo)致指紋識(shí)別失敗,采用基于相似度的分類算法則可解決此問題。
發(fā)明內(nèi)容
本發(fā)明的一個(gè)目的是解決至少上述問題,并提供至少后面將說明的優(yōu)點(diǎn)。
本發(fā)明還有一個(gè)目的是提供一種基于指紋相似度的設(shè)備分類方法,提高了設(shè)備分類的效率和準(zhǔn)確性,并避免了因信息發(fā)送變化,導(dǎo)致的指紋識(shí)別失敗的問題。
為了實(shí)現(xiàn)根據(jù)本發(fā)明的這些目的和其它優(yōu)點(diǎn),提供了一種基于指紋相似度的設(shè)備分類方法,包括:
步驟1、通過建立已知的同一類型設(shè)備的樣本集,并提取所述樣本集對(duì)應(yīng)的指紋信息,以得到所述指紋信息的平均相似度和中心點(diǎn)樣本指紋集。
步驟2、通過獲取所述樣本集內(nèi)的每個(gè)設(shè)備與步驟1所得中心點(diǎn)樣本指紋集的相似度,計(jì)算每個(gè)已知類型設(shè)備指紋信息的所述相似度到所述中心點(diǎn)樣本指紋集的相似距離,并確定最大相似距離。
步驟3、通過計(jì)算未知類型設(shè)備集內(nèi)每個(gè)樣本與所述中心點(diǎn)樣本指紋集的中心點(diǎn)樣本的空間距離,與所述最大相似距離進(jìn)行比較,若大于所述最大相似距離,則所述樣本屬于所述中心點(diǎn)樣本集所在的樣本類型,否則,所述樣本不屬于所述樣本類型,若出現(xiàn)未正確識(shí)別的樣本,則進(jìn)入步驟4。
步驟4、通過將未正確識(shí)別的樣本重新加入所述樣本集,以重新計(jì)算所述中心點(diǎn)樣本,重復(fù)步驟1-3,以完成自動(dòng)分類。
優(yōu)選的是,步驟1中,得到所述指紋信息的平均相似度和中心點(diǎn)樣本指紋集的具體方法包括以下步驟:
步驟2.1、通過多個(gè)已知的同一類型的設(shè)備建立樣本集N,提取所述樣本集N內(nèi)每個(gè)設(shè)備對(duì)應(yīng)的指紋信息。
步驟2.2、通過計(jì)算所述樣本集N內(nèi)每個(gè)設(shè)備指紋信息對(duì)應(yīng)屬性的相似度,取所述相似度的平均值作為平均相似度。
步驟2.3、獲取所述相似度中與所述平均值接近的多個(gè)相似度作為所述中心點(diǎn)樣本指紋集。
優(yōu)選的是,步驟2中,獲取所述相似度的具體方法包括以下步驟:
步驟3.1、獲取所述樣本集內(nèi)設(shè)備對(duì)應(yīng)的多個(gè)維度信息,計(jì)算與所述中心點(diǎn)樣本指紋集的相似度。
步驟3.2、對(duì)所述樣本集內(nèi)除所述中心點(diǎn)樣本之外的所述設(shè)備重復(fù)步驟3.1,直至得到除所述中心點(diǎn)樣本之外的所有的每個(gè)所述設(shè)備的相似度。
優(yōu)選的是,步驟2中,獲取所述相似距離的計(jì)算方法依據(jù)公式1:
公式1
其中,X(i)為樣本對(duì)應(yīng)的多個(gè)維度信息與所述中心點(diǎn)樣本指紋集的相似度;
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于國家計(jì)算機(jī)網(wǎng)絡(luò)與信息安全管理中心;遠(yuǎn)江盛邦(北京)網(wǎng)絡(luò)安全科技股份有限公司,未經(jīng)國家計(jì)算機(jī)網(wǎng)絡(luò)與信息安全管理中心;遠(yuǎn)江盛邦(北京)網(wǎng)絡(luò)安全科技股份有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201910735429.8/2.html,轉(zhuǎn)載請(qǐng)聲明來源鉆瓜專利網(wǎng)。
- 上一篇:一種基于駕駛員監(jiān)控系統(tǒng)的安全帶檢測(cè)方法以及相應(yīng)的設(shè)備
- 下一篇:一種有效手勢(shì)的識(shí)別方法、控制方法、裝置和電子設(shè)備
- 同類專利
- 專利分類
G06K 數(shù)據(jù)識(shí)別;數(shù)據(jù)表示;記錄載體;記錄載體的處理
G06K9-00 用于閱讀或識(shí)別印刷或書寫字符或者用于識(shí)別圖形,例如,指紋的方法或裝置
G06K9-03 .錯(cuò)誤的檢測(cè)或校正,例如,用重復(fù)掃描圖形的方法
G06K9-18 .應(yīng)用具有附加代碼標(biāo)記或含有代碼標(biāo)記的打印字符的,例如,由不同形狀的各個(gè)筆畫組成的,而且每個(gè)筆畫表示不同的代碼值的字符
G06K9-20 .圖像捕獲
G06K9-36 .圖像預(yù)處理,即無須判定關(guān)于圖像的同一性而進(jìn)行的圖像信息處理
G06K9-60 .圖像捕獲和多種預(yù)處理作用的組合
- 傳感設(shè)備、檢索設(shè)備和中繼設(shè)備
- 簽名設(shè)備、檢驗(yàn)設(shè)備、驗(yàn)證設(shè)備、加密設(shè)備及解密設(shè)備
- 色彩調(diào)整設(shè)備、顯示設(shè)備、打印設(shè)備、圖像處理設(shè)備
- 驅(qū)動(dòng)設(shè)備、定影設(shè)備和成像設(shè)備
- 發(fā)送設(shè)備、中繼設(shè)備和接收設(shè)備
- 定點(diǎn)設(shè)備、接口設(shè)備和顯示設(shè)備
- 傳輸設(shè)備、DP源設(shè)備、接收設(shè)備以及DP接受設(shè)備
- 設(shè)備綁定方法、設(shè)備、終端設(shè)備以及網(wǎng)絡(luò)側(cè)設(shè)備
- 設(shè)備、主設(shè)備及從設(shè)備
- 設(shè)備向設(shè)備轉(zhuǎn)發(fā)





